HAWES v. TRAVELERS INSURANCE COMPANY

No. 569.

131 F.Supp. 440 (1955)

Benjamin W. HAWES, Plaintiff, v. The TRAVELERS INSURANCE COMPANY, Defendant.

United States District Court W. D. Kentucky, Owensboro Division.

May 30, 1955.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Thomas E. Sandidge, Owensboro, Ky., for plaintiff.

John B. Anderson, Owensboro, Ky., for defendant.


SWINFORD, District Judge.

This is an action in which the plaintiff seeks a declaration of his rights under the terms of an insurance policy issued to him by the defendant on September 12, 1939. The plaintiff prays that the court declare him to be totally and permanently disabled within the terms and meaning of the policy and from that fact adjudge that the waiver of premiums provisions of the policy is now in effect.
